What blessing equipment looks like

Just press the "Bless Item" button in the inventory to get started

Keep in mind that the gem comination in the picture is just to show what it looks like, the stats on the bow is not the result of the combination of these two gems.

The amount of gems in this picture is 50 in each slot because the level of the item being blessed is 50. If you have an item that is level 34, the amount of gems in each slot would be 34.

You can bless an item as many times as you want but the next time you bless an already blessed item it will be overriden. So make sure you bless the item with the combinations you want.

To maximize a stat on an item you would need to combine two gems in all the slots except the lonely slot.

There is one slot that cannot be combined, this slot gives a raw stat. If you for an example put a red gem inside it will give you damage. You can put any gem inside this slot for different raw stats.

Blessing interface looks different for each class and have different slots.

Gem Link Combinations
You need to unlock the "Bless Item" feature before you can do this. Just play through the campaign and you will eventually unlock this.
A link gem (orange small triangle) needs to be put in between the gems that will be combined.

Blue = Armour
Green = Max HP
Red = Damage
Yellow = Crit Dmg %

Combos

Red + Yellow = Dmg / Crit Dmg / Crit %
Red + Blue = Armour / AP/ Dmg
Red + Green = Dmg / Max HP

Yellow + Red = As above
Yellow + Blue = Armour/ Crit Dmg / Max Energy
Yellow + Green = Crit Dmg / DoT / Max HP

Blue + Red = As above
Blue + Yellow = As above
Blue + Green = Armour/ Max HP/ Counter Attack Dmg

@JPDayz Yes you can stack crit chance links and it does improve rolls. The mage if fully linking crit chance then it goes up to 2,5% crit chance while an archer (elessa) only goes up to 1,9%
